Potterton Main burner does not light Fault Code
Also written as MAINBURNERDOESNOTLIGHT — same fault.
The Potterton Main burner does not light fault code means: your boiler is failing to ignite the main flame, which means you currently have no heating or hot water because the system cannot generate the heat needed.. It appears on 1 Potterton model in our database.
Technical description: Does burner light? Check 240v +/- 10% between electronic control T2 and T6
Engineer required
This fault requires a Gas Safe registered engineer. Do not attempt gas-related repairs yourself.
